SO RELAX store
in Westfield Valley Fair, Santa Clara, California

Mall Store Name: SO RELAX

Mall Name: Westfield Valley Fair

Mall Address: 2855 STEVENS CREEK BLVD., SANTA CLARA, California - CA 95050-6709

Brand: So Relax

Store Categories: Health and Beauty, Services - Photography, Optical, Financial, ...

GPS Coordinates:  37.32591, -121.945609

Address detail: City: Santa Clara, State: California - CA
Telephone (Mall): 408 248 4451
This Store is: Store


Directions to SO RELAX - Westfield Valley Fair

SO RELAX in Westfield Valley Fair is located in Santa Clara, California - CA. Store location: 2855 STEVENS CREEK BLVD.

Get Directions to SO RELAX (GPS: 37.32591, -121.945609)

Other So Relax stores

Check all So Relax stores!

All Brands

Malls & Stores Locator

Bookmark & Share

Bookmark our website and stay in touch. Share and like Malls and Stores Info on Facebook and get News, Information about Sales and Events.


The most visited brands